Hard drive Testing: Test your disk drive - Create a Bootable CD: or connect the drive to anther PC and install the appropriate test software Note: Hard drive reliability has gone way down in the last 24 months and improved a bit lately depending on the manufacture.

Drive manufacture's utilities list: If you have a new Seagate hard drive the very next thing would be to download Seagate's Seatools the bootable CD and check for bad sectors. This site in other languages x.
